Output 3a013e66eceb79b923e91d904fe68b71d9b6f995fdf19a0c7f66f3da0d7b3906:1

value
155297574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9309ff9a3c8ad5a80c36784e842e9859c86ee56 OP_EQUAL
address
3JaDBYr1URo7hfNMA2Xi5L1eXUZSLGTb3w
transaction
3a013e66eceb79b923e91d904fe68b71d9b6f995fdf19a0c7f66f3da0d7b3906
spent
true